Seminoles, a Native American tribe primarily located in Florida and Oklahoma, traditionally practiced some forms of polygamy, particularly in the 19th century. However, contemporary Seminole culture, like many others, has largely moved away from polygamous practices. Today, monogamous relationships are more common among Seminoles, reflecting broader societal norms.
